Berean Baptist Academy and The O'Neal School are an even 4-4 against one another since August of 2022, but not for long. The Bulldogs will welcome the Falcons at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. Berean Baptist Academy is coming into the contest on a five-game losing streak.
Berean Baptist Academy lost 3-0 to Fayetteville Christian on Tuesday.
While Berean Baptist Academy ultimately came up short, they really made Fayetteville Christian work, particularly in the second set.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-22, 27-25, 25-16.
Meanwhile, there's no place like home for The O'Neal School,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Monday. Everything went their way against Freedom Christian Academy on Tuesday as they made off with a 3-0 win.
The O'Neal School didn't let Freedom Christian Academy take a single set, but it sure wasn't easy: every set was decided by three points or less. The match finished with set scores of 25-22, 25-22, 25-23.
The O'Neal School is on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 5-10 record this season. As for Berean Baptist Academy, their defeat dropped their record down to 5-12.
Berean Baptist Academy skirted past The O'Neal School 3-2 in their previous meeting back in September. Do the Bulldogs have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Falcons tur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
